Sep 2, 2015, 2:13 pm627 ptsReally, Apple? A new report from 9to5Mac confirms that the upcoming iPhone 6s and iPhone 6s Plus will start with a 16GB base model. Apple will also offer a 64 and 128GB version of both phones. The on-contract pricing structure will also stay the same as in 2014. That means the iPhone 6s models will cost $199,…
